Wisconsin Requirements (What You Must Know)

Minimum Liability

Current WI minimums are $25,000/$50,000 bodily injury and $10,000 property damage. We’ll quote higher limits that better fit Barron’s rural and highway exposure.

No PIP on Motorcycles

Standard WI auto insurance doesn’t include PIP for motorcycles. Add Medical Payments (MedPay) to help with medical expenses regardless of fault.

Helmet & Eye Protection

WI requires helmets for riders under 18; all riders should wear approved helmets. Eye protection is recommended for safety on open roads.

Inspection & Lane Splitting

No routine state inspection required (keep equipment roadworthy). Lane splitting isn’t permitted in WI-follow traffic laws closely.

Getting Your WI Motorcycle Endorsement

Course Path (Recommended)

  • Enroll in an approved Basic RiderCourse (BRC)
  • Pass the course; bring completion card to DMV
  • Add the M endorsement (often no road test needed)

Permit + Testing Path

  • Get motorcycle examination permit (knowledge + vision)
  • Practice under permit restrictions
  • Take DMV road test; add M endorsement

Bike Size & Restrictions

Testing on a small bike can trigger restrictions. Completing an approved course typically removes this-ask us if you’re unsure.

Motorcycle Insurance FAQ - Barron, WI

Is lane splitting legal in Wisconsin?

Wisconsin does not permit lane splitting. Riders may be cited under general traffic laws for unsafe passing.

Do motorcycles get PIP benefits in WI?

No. WI doesn’t provide PIP for motorcycles. Add MedPay and strong UM/UIM limits for protection.

What are the current WI minimum insurance limits?

For policies now, at least 25/50/10. We’ll quote higher limits for better protection on rural roads.

Do I need a helmet in Wisconsin?

Helmets are required for riders under 18; all riders are encouraged to wear them for safety.

Do motorcycles require inspections?

No routine inspections are required, but your bike must be roadworthy to avoid citations.

Will ABS lower my premium?

Many carriers offer discounts for ABS, as it reduces crash risks in studies.
